In recent years, mobile banking has transformed the landscape of financial services. With the rise of smartphones and mobile technology, consumers demand seamless, fast, and secure banking solutions at their fingertips. This article delves into the current trends and innovations in mobile banking software development, exploring how financial institutions can leverage these advancements to enhance customer experiences and remain competitive in an ever-evolving market.
The Rise of Mobile Banking
Statistics show that the majority of consumers now prefer to manage their finances via mobile applications. According to a report by Statista, the global mobile banking market is projected to reach over $1 trillion by 2026. With such significant growth, financial institutions prioritize mobile banking services to attract and retain customers. Understanding the drivers behind this trend is crucial for software developers aiming to create effective mobile banking solutions.
Key Features for Modern Mobile Banking Apps
Building an effective mobile banking application requires understanding the features that users find most valuable. The essentials include:
- User-Friendly Interface: An intuitive design ensures that customers can navigate the app without confusion. Usability is key in retaining new users who may not be tech-savvy.
- Security Protocols: With the increase in online fraud, robust security measures such as two-factor authentication, biometric verification, and end-to-end encryption are non-negotiable.
- Personal Finance Management Tools: Features that allow users to track spending, set budgets, and receive insights into their financial habits add value to the app. Gamifying these features can increase user engagement.
- Instant Money Transfers: Instant fund transfers enhance user satisfaction, especially among millennials and Gen Z users who demand immediacy.
- 24/7 Customer Support: Implementing AI chatbots that provide instant assistance can significantly improve customer service and reduce operational costs.
The Role of AI and Machine Learning
Artificial Intelligence (AI) and Machine Learning (ML) are revolutionizing various industries, and mobile banking is no exception. Financial institutions are increasingly utilizing these technologies to enhance user experience. Here are some innovative applications of AI and ML in mobile banking software development:
- Fraud Detection: AI can analyze user behavior and detect anomalies in transactions that might indicate fraud, providing banks with advanced tools to protect their customers.
- Personalized Recommendations: ML algorithms can offer personalized financial advice based on user spending patterns, creating a more tailored banking experience.
- Chatbots for Customer Service: AI-driven chatbots can handle customer inquiries and support requests, improving response times and user satisfaction.
Blockchain Technology in Mobile Banking
Blockchain technology holds the potential to revolutionize mobile banking by offering enhanced security and transparency. As banks explore the implementation of blockchain, several key benefits become apparent:
- Enhanced Security: The decentralized nature of blockchain makes it more resistant to hacking attempts compared to traditional centralized databases.
- Efficient Transactions: Blockchain allows for peer-to-peer transactions without intermediaries, significantly reducing transaction costs and times.
- Smart Contracts: These self-executing contracts with the terms directly written into code can automate many banking processes, increasing efficiency and reducing human errors.
Focus on Customer Experience
The customer experience is at the forefront of mobile banking software development. Banks are investing in UX/UI design to ensure that the app meets user expectations. A study by the Digital Banking Report indicated that over 60% of consumers are willing to switch banks for a better digital experience. Here are some strategies to enhance customer experience:
- Streamlined Onboarding: Simplifying the account setup process can significantly enhance user satisfaction. Utilizing APIs for identity verification can expedite this process.
- Feedback Loops: Regularly gathering user feedback and making necessary adjustments to the app fosters a sense of community and engagement.
- Education and Support: Providing resources and educational content within the app can empower users to make informed financial decisions.
Future Trends in Mobile Banking Software Development
As technology continues to evolve, several trends are emerging in the field of mobile banking:
- Open Banking: The rise of APIs allows third-party developers to create innovative banking solutions that enhance the mobile app experience.
- Increased Use of Biometric Authentication: Fingerprint and facial recognition technologies provide an additional layer of security, improving user trust in mobile banking applications.
- Sustainable Banking Solutions: As consumers become more environmentally conscious, banks are integrating sustainable features into their mobile apps, such as tracking carbon footprints and offering green investment options.
Challenges in Mobile Banking Software Development
While the future of mobile banking looks promising, developers face significant challenges. Compliance with regulations, ensuring data privacy, and managing cybersecurity risks remain top priorities. As the landscape of mobile banking continues to evolve, developers must stay up-to-date with regulatory changes and technological advancements.
Collaborating with Fintech Startups
The collaboration between traditional banks and fintech startups is thriving. These partnerships can drive innovation and create agile mobile banking solutions that meet the needs of modern consumers. By leveraging the nimbleness of fintech companies, banks can incorporate the latest technologies without the lengthy development cycles conventional endeavors tend to face.
Final Thoughts
The rapid advancements in mobile technology and changing customer preferences are reshaping the future of mobile banking software development. As banks continue to innovate and enhance their mobile services, it is critical to focus on customer needs, leverage new technologies, and remain adaptable to ensure success in this competitive environment.